Electric Scooters Clean Mobility Startup Johanson3 hits 1.3M USD on Crowdfunder

Electric scooter technology startup company Johanson3 has taken in its first tranche of funding -- announcing a $1.3 million Investment on Crowdfunder. The company aims to make commuting easier and safer; currently, Johanson3 is taking on new investors for launching its startup internationally from the USA.


SAN FRANCISCO, Calif., April 2, 2015 (GLOBE NEWSWIRE) -- via PRWEB - Delaware-based transportation startup is seeking companies to invest in its expansion overseas. CEO Johan Neerman says funding will pave the way for improved scooter features and a wider market. Alongside investment from Delta Lloyd Bank, Johanson3 is also working with the USA PPI Group to perfect the scooter design. PPI Group is a Virginia company that focuses on high-tech production and marketing. USA Missouri based frame manufacturer Thompson Choppers has been short listed for frame production.

The patented technology of Johanson3's clean energy vehicles requires the company to use licensing and joint ventures to extend their business. In an effort to make commuting more enjoyable and safe,Johanson3 is dedicated to easing the driver experience. Delivering more options such as item and passenger carry allow the driver to mold the scooter to meet whatever needs. The foldable design too aids in adaptability, making the scooter malleable enough to fit in the back of a car or in the corner of a room when not in use.

The design is made up of a 3-wheel skeleton for steady driving. Three engines and removable batteries make up the scooter, able to reach speeds of 50 mph and transport as much as 660 lbs at a time. This top competitor of scooters sells for $3000 USD. 4 batteries packs will provide a range of about 140 miles.
